About the Role

The mission of the U.S. Attorney's Office for the District of Rhode Island is to uphold federal law with fairness and integrity, ensuring the safety of all who live, work, and visit the Ocean State. The Office prosecutes federal offenses and represents the United States in criminal matters before the United States District Court and appellate courts. https://www.justice.gov/usao-ri

What You'll Do

  • The United States Attorney's Office is seeking an experienced and motivated attorney to serve as an Assistant United States Attorney (AUSA) in the Criminal Division.
  • Assistant U.S.
  • Attorneys (AUSAs) in the Criminal Division direct the investigation and prosecution of diverse federal offenses.
  • The caseload encompasses, but is not limited to, a broad spectrum of criminal litigation, including violent crime, sophisticated financial fraud, public corruption, human trafficking, narcotics distribution, and national security matters.
  • AUSAs are responsible for the entire litigation lifecycle, from providing legal guidance during the investigative stage to representing the United States at sentencing and asset forfeiture proceedings.
  • Key Duties & Expectations The successful candidate must demonstrate the ability to: Lead Investigations: Partner with federal law enforcement agencies to develop and execute complex investigative strategies.
  • Grand Jury Practice: Manage all aspects of grand jury proceedings, including subpoenas, witness testimony, and the presentation of evidence.
  • Independent Litigation: Manage a demanding docket of moderate-to-high complexity cases with minimal supervision, demonstrating superior oral advocacy and written work product.
  • Adaptive Expertise: Quickly master new substantive areas of law and Department of Justice policies in a fast-paced, high-pressure environment.
  • Responsibilities will increase, and assignments will become more complex as your training and experience progress.
